In celebration of Singapore’s 60th birthday, heritage bakery brand Old Seng Choong has launched a limited-edition Pandan Coffee Chiffon Cake, bringing together two iconic local flavours in a single nostalgic treat.
The new release commemorates six decades of national progress while honouring the brand’s roots. Established by renowned local pastry chef Daniel Tay, Old Seng Choong is a tribute to Tay’s father and the original Seng Choong Confectionery that served generations of Marine Parade residents in the 1960s.
The Pandan Coffee Chiffon Cake combines the bold aroma of traditional 1980s-style kopi with the fragrant sweetness of pandan, resulting in a light, springy chiffon cake designed to appeal to all ages.
In addition to the chiffon cake, Old Seng Choong is offering a special SG60 Bundle that includes two other nostalgic favourites: Coffee Cookies and Pandan Coconut Cookies. Beautifully packaged in a commemorative gift box.
Both items are available at all Old Seng Choong retail outlets and on the brand’s official e-commerce store.
